Before you arrive
There's nothing special to prepare. Arrive with clean skin where possible, and avoid alcohol and blood-thinning medication (such as ibuprofen or aspirin, where medically appropriate) for 24 hours beforehand, as this can increase bruising.
The consultation
Dr Maral will talk through your medical history, any medications, previous treatments, and what you're hoping to achieve. This isn't a formality — it's how she decides whether treatment is appropriate for you, and which areas will give the most natural-looking result.
The treatment
Once you're both happy to proceed, the injections themselves are quick — most appointments are complete within 30–45 minutes including consultation time. A fine needle is used, and most people describe the sensation as a brief scratch rather than significant pain.
Immediately after
You can typically return to normal activities straight away. Dr Maral will talk you through aftercare before you leave — see our Botox Aftercare guide for the full detail.

How long does the appointment take?
Around 30–45 minutes including consultation.
Will I see results immediately?
Full effect typically develops over 1–2 weeks.
Do I need to do anything before I come in?
Avoid alcohol and blood-thinning medication for 24 hours beforehand if possible.
